    Decided to try Prime burger since I've walked past many times while staying at the Palazzo. They have a number of different burgers with various toppings. They have other items as well like chicken sandwiches, buffalo wings, onion rings, salads and milkshakes. I ordered the Americana burger with grilled onions and added bacon. Fries come separately. (I had a feeling the burger would be huge so I didn't order fries.) The burger was freshly prepared to my liking and had an ample amount of toppings. It was a nice size as well. I barely finished it. It was juicy and very flavorful. This is definitely a place to check out if want a really good burger.

    As we were walking by the huge picture of their Moo burger caught all four sets of our eyes. We all stopped to glance at the menu. As we were deciding we were told there would be a twenty minutes wait as there was only one server. The guy seemed overwhelmed to say the least so we obviously left. We walked around a bit more but ended up coming back because the burgers sounded and looked pretty good. We waited for about 8-10 minutes to be seated. No one ahead of us and not very many tables remained. Luckily by the time we came back I guess things had settled because that same server was a bit less flustered. We waited about another 8-10 minutes for a drink order but he did eventually come and take it. Then just as we ordered our drinks another waitress walked in. She finished us up and was very pleasant. The burgers were delicious. The sound a lot fancier than they tasted especially with all the meats they grind together for the Patty. The extras like the bacon tomato relish and grilled onions were great on the 21st Century. I wish there had been a bit more of the bacon relish but it was still good. The egg yolk oozed through the burger once we cut it and although messy, it was great. The fries are an add on extra for about $5 or $7 for sweet potato fries. Both are delicious but the sweet potato fries were better to me. I enjoy the sweet with the salty and really liked the crispiness with the soft inside. They were able to accommodate a gluten free allergy with a gluten free bun. They were very nice and considerate about it and didn't charge any extra for the gf bun. The burgers were definitely more top notch than In & Out and you are paying for that quality upgrade. They are a good size though and great to share.

    Solid breakfast food and definitely filling. Arrived at Venetian rather early in the morning and browsing the Canal Shops this place was open. Breakfast options are what you would expect to see and fair pricing. No wait when I arrived, but around 9:30a there was a wait. Went with Breakfast Sandwich which comes with potatoes, $12. Food came out rather quickly and everything was as ordered, hot and fresh. The egg comes scrambled on the sandwich and pretty sure it's 2 eggs because the sandwich was quite big and has 2 slices of cheese, 2 pieces of bacon. Lots of taters! Bottled still water is Acqua Panna, which I love. This place hits the spot for breakfast! Service was friendly as well!
